In 1919, Leona Magdline Davis entered the world in Crestview OK, Florida, born to James Elbert Bud Davis And Lila E Davis. In 1930, Leona Magdline Davis resided in Crestview, Okaloosa, Florida, USA. In 1935, Leona Magdline Davis resided in Precinct 15, Okaloosa, Florida. Leona Magdline Davis had children including Betty Carolyn Hayes, Lila Jo Thomas. Leona Magdline Davis passed away in 2000 in Crestview, Okaloosa County, Florida, United States of America.
